All casts are typically composed of: 
 
a albumin 
b globulin 
c immunoglobulins G and M 
d uromodulin - correct answers.d uromodulin 
 
Using polarized light microscopy, which of the following urinary elements are birefringent: 
 
a cholesterol 
b triglycerides 
c fatty acids 
d neutral fats - correct answers.a cholesterol

A patient with uncontrolled diabetes mellitus will most likely have: - ANSWERSpale urine with a high specific gravity 
 
while performing an analysis of a baby's urine, the lab notices the specimen has a mousy odor. of the following substances that may be excreted in urine, the one that most characteristically produces this odor is: - ANSWERSphenylpyruvic acid 
 
An ammonia-like odor is characteristically associated with urine from patients who: - ANSWERShave an infection with proteus, spp

Give some examples of situations in which urine could have the following abnormal colorations 
 
a) red 
b) dark yellow/amber 
a) red: most commonly caused by blood; additional causes may be red blood cells, hemoglobin, myoglobin caused by muscle trauma 
 
b) dark yellow/amber: dehydration, infection, fever, or liver problems like hepatitis
